Spectrum Centre

spectrum-logoThe Spectrum Centre is a major landmark in the Greater Shankill area.  It has developed as an Arts and Culture venue which lies in the heart of the community.

Special interest groups are encouraged to use the facilities for community purposes.

Flexibility is important to us at the Spectrum Centre and we believe in working with our clients to maximise their use and enjoyment of our facilities.

Greater Shankill Partnership at The Spectrum Centre, Shankill Road, BelfastWe are bringing events to the centre which will entertain and stimulate an interest in the arts.

The Spectrum Centre joined forces with Audiences N.I.  to offer the opportunity for people to “ test-drive the arts” whereby members of the public can attend arts and cultural events for free.

The Spectrum Centre is a subsidiary company of the Greater Shankill Partnership. It is a private limited company and is for the most part independent of funding, although there is current subsidy from the Arts Council. The General Manager reports to the board of the Spectrum Centre.
